During today's events in Glasgow at the MCM Scotland Comic Con, Andrew Partridge was on hand to talk about the forthcoming Scotland Loves Anime, while also unveiling something very special he has up his sleeve for next month's MCM London Comic Con.
On Saturday, 24th October, a venue close to the ExCeL in London will play host to the world premiere (yes, that means even before it's released or screened in Japan!) of the second instalment of Gundam The Origin, subtitled Artesia's Sorrow. This will be one of a number of screenings planned across the duration of the day, in a line-up that will also include the theatrical premiere of the first episode of Gundam The Origin.
More details, including exact times, location and ticketing information, will appear next week, so stay tuned and we'll furnish you with further information as soon as we have it!
EDIT: Anime Limited have now posted more details about this event, dubbed MCM Loves Anime, on their blog - screenings will take place at The Crystal near the ExCeL exhibition centre, and the premiere of Gundam The Origin will also be followed by a talk from representitives of production studio Sunrise.
There will be four screenings in total at the event, with one of the remaining films heavily hinted to be Love Live The Movie.
